As I was telling Bribo earlier on the phone, you need to get used to the "Apple Paradigm" for dealing with organizing your music. On the PC many of us have intricate playlist and hugely complicated folder structures. All of that goes away.

People panic when they're told that iTunes lumps everything in one folder by default. Thing is, the software lifts the load of organization from your shoulders. It doesn't MATTER where it is on the disk, so long as you can find it in a flash. And that's what iTunes does so well.
